Role Overview
A skilled and reliable Drainage Engineer is sought to support the maintenance installation and repair of drainage systems. The position involves hands-on technical work troubleshooting faults and ensuring compliance with safety and quality standards. The role requires a proactive team player capable of managing both independent and collaborative tasks within a close-knit operational team.
Key Responsibilities
- Install maintain and repair drainage components using appropriate tools and equipment.
- Conduct CCTV inspections to identify and diagnose issues within drainage systems.
- Unblock drains using high-pressure water jetting equipment.
- Evaluate existing drainage conditions to recommend improvements or required upgrades.
- Work with colleagues contractors and engineers to ensure seamless project delivery.
- Complete job cards with accurate details regarding labour materials and time spent.
- Conduct routine maintenance checks and report any issues promptly.
- Participate in a rotating on-call schedule (1 in 3 weeks).
Required Skills & Experience
- Proven experience in drainage operations or a related field (minimum 1 year preferred).
- Proficient in using hand tools and power tools safely and effectively.
- Sound plumbing knowledge is an advantage.
- Strong problem-solving abilities and keen attention to detail.
- Basic math skills for accurate measurements and calculations.
- Excellent communication and teamwork abilities.
- Full UK driving licence (essential).
- CSCS card (preferred).
- Physically fit and capable of manual handling tasks.
